Hello, I have a layer in a web map that has about 30 fields in it, and I'd like to show only those fields that do not show NULL values. As shown in the screenshot below, the ideal outcome is to show only the field names and values that have a value, so there aren't a bunch of blank records. Full disclosure...programming is not my strong suite! I've been poking around with google searches on how to use Arcade to filter out empty values from an array of fields, and using 'IIF' statements, but haven't quite found exactly what I'm looking for. If any of you have a custom-configured Arcade script from a web map where you filtered out the NULL values you'd be willing to share it would be greatly appreciated!

Just got off the phone with ESRI Tech Support and confirmed that it was my ESRI Profile that got corrupted somehow (which can happen if you abruptly end a task, among other things). The solution was to close all ArcGIS Pro and ArcMap documents, rename the 'ESRI' folder under C:\Users\<user name>\AppData\Local & Roaming to 'ESRI_old'. After that, open ArcGIS Pro and it will create new ESRI Profile folders (you will just need to re-set your connections, template, etc.). After that it worked just fine. Hello, I am unable to access the properties of a legend after importing an ArcMap (10.5) layout into a Pro (2.3.2) layout. I deleted the old legend associated with the ArcMap Document and added a brand new one. I can see my layers but when I right-click to access the properties nothing comes up. I can only edit the formatting (even with that, I can't access any further functions for Text Symbol or Symbol by clicking the arrow on the bottom-right). I'm assuming this may be due to the fact that it was imported from ArcMap....seems like buggy behavior. Thank you, Dan

Hello, I want to re-iterate what Michael Volz just replied. I had opened a ticket last month with ESRI Premium tech support, and used the ‘Select By Location’ tool as an example in that case. The simple selection I was doing was selecting the parcels on a remote SQL Server with one district polygon – ultimately selecting a subset of about 200 parcels. In ArcMap this operation takes about 1 – 2 seconds, but in Pro it took over 8 minutes on my end. Thankfully ESRI could reproduce the error (faster than 8 minutes, but still unacceptable) and the results are below. They have logged it as a bug and will send it on to development. The issue seems to be working with any remote database….Pro is very chatty and slow in that regard. Overall, I like using Pro and use it everyday, but I agree that the performance needs work still, and this issue is preventing us (LA County) from fully switching over. Like has been said earlier in the string of this post, if we all work with Tech Support on different Geoprocessing tasks then they will get a loud and clear message that the software needs further configuration. This Select By Location task was just one example, I've had performance issues with joins, exporting to excel, spatial joins and other fairly straightforward Geoprocessing tasks. From ESRI… File Geodatabase: – ArcMap 10.6.1: Less than a second. – ArcGIS Pro 2.2.4: Less than a second. – ArcGIS Pro 2.3 Beta: Less than a second. SQL Server: – ArcMap 10.6.1: Less than a second. – ArcGIS Pro 2.2.4: 3 minutes, 45 seconds. – ArcGIS Pro 2.3 Beta: 3 minutes, 9 seconds. Oracle: – ArcMap 10.6.1: Less than two seconds. – ArcGIS Pro 2.2.4: 3 minutes, 57 seconds. – ArcGIS Pro 2.3 Beta: 3 minutes, 25 seconds. PostgreSQL: – ArcMap 10.6.1: About 3 seconds. – ArcGIS Pro 2.2.4: 1 minute, 43 seconds. – ArcGIS Pro 2.3 Beta: 1 minute, 3 seconds. Thanks, Dan
